Output 74b0dcc775233e56017b0f7006131817bba84a2a9622c67fdc7cdba1c77ea80e:5

value
2943
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3f394c79a3e1a1eacfb0307eeb020ff6b7c1f91bf309648dec625431b4908ba5
address
bc1p8uu5c7druxs74nasxplwkqs076mur7gm7vykfr0vvf2rrdys3wjsrrpadl
transaction
74b0dcc775233e56017b0f7006131817bba84a2a9622c67fdc7cdba1c77ea80e
confirmations
96853
spent
true